Output ebb64a6a2a09a673f5504820bd5175357194f69c79b5f46ca366717ad9f3a975:0

value
10943262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ddb96e1e2ac7af00807b7ac40a4285d8df01311 OP_EQUAL
address
32xHmNjFXibMhExJghNLuiVXHVWYHbq2Xp
transaction
ebb64a6a2a09a673f5504820bd5175357194f69c79b5f46ca366717ad9f3a975
spent
true